5km. One Cause. Thousands of Steps for CANSA – Rosebank Mall’s 5KM Pink Run is Back!

Get ready to run, walk or skip your way to making a real difference this October
Ready to turn the streets of Rosebank – and yourselves – pink? Rosebank Mall’s 5KM Pink Run is back on Saturday, 25 October 2025 at 7:00am – and it’s calling on Joburgers of all ages to lace up, show up and move for a cause that matters. Picture this: hundreds of people in varying shades of pink, music pumping, energy high, all united around an incredible cause. Sounds fun right? Get ready to run through a rainbow! This year’s event will feature vibrant bursts of powder showering down on you.
Rosebank Mall Marketing Manager, Angelisa Gengan commented: “The Pink Run has become something special for our community – a morning where fitness, fun and fundraising come together for an incredible cause. Watching participants of all ages unite around CANSA’s mission every year reminds us why we do this.”

Your Money, Real Impact
At just R100 for adults and R80 for kids, it’s one of the most affordable ways to make a genuine impact whilst having a brilliant morning out. A portion of the ticket sales goes straight to CANSA, funding everything from cutting-edge research to early detection programmes and patient support. When you cross that finish line, you’ll know you’ve contributed to potentially saving lives.
“Working with CANSA, whose dedication to cancer patients and families is truly remarkable, remains one of our proudest partnerships. Our participants bring such energy and heart to this event – they’re the ones who make it extraordinary. We’re expecting this year to be our biggest and most impactful yet,” enthused Gengan.
CANSA’s work touches thousands of South African families every year, providing hope, support and practical help when it matters most. By showing up on 25 October, you’re showing up for them too.

Event Details:
Tickets are live now via Peak Time:
📅Date: Saturday, 25 October 2025
⌚Time: 7:00 AM
📍Venue: Rosebank Mall, Bath Avenue, Rosebank
🎟️Ticket Prices: R100 for adults, R80 for children.
